Transaction 3421b49a56ff2ec423a47eae86a6dcd580308083adf20f7792ffc8cc50a79fe9
1 Input
1 Output
-
3421b49a56ff2ec423a47eae86a6dcd580308083adf20f7792ffc8cc50a79fe9:0
- value
- 366530
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ebde25d541b13ee2ce599d41b49643e9cedd496
- address
- bc1q3677yh25rvf7ut89n82pkjty86wwm4yknpfgpc